Our client is seeking a Senior Software Developer – C# to join their team!
About Our Client
Our client is a leading provider of innovative robotic programming solutions, trusted by global industry leaders. Their platform integrates advanced features like 3D scanning and automated path optimization, making industrial automation accessible and efficient for high-mix, high-complexity operations across various sectors.
What you'll be doing?
- Lead and Mentor: Guide junior developers, conduct code reviews, and provide performance feedback to foster team growth and success.
- Innovate with C#: Design and optimize software modules, enhancing existing features for improved usability, scalability, and performance.
- Drive Agile Development: Collaborate with the Product Manager in sprint planning, daily stand-ups, and retrospectives, ensuring timely and quality deliveries.
- Ensure Seamless Integration: Oversee the integration of software components across different systems and perform unit testing for high-quality, reliable software.
- Grow Your Expertise: Develop your skills in robotic programming, system integration, and machine vision through hands-on experience and internal training opportunities.
Who are they looking for?
- Tech-Savvy Professional: Hold a Bachelor's degree in Computer Science, Software Engineering, or a related field, with strong proficiency in C# and solid programming fundamentals.
- Leadership Experience: Demonstrate proven ability in leading and managing a software development team effectively.
- Architecture Enthusiast: Possess a strong understanding of software architecture, object-oriented programming, and SOLID principles.
- Agile Practitioner: Familiar with Agile development practices and proficient in tools like Jira and Confluence for efficient project management.
- Collaborative Problem-Solver: Excel in teamwork with excellent problem-solving skills and keen attention to detail.
- Continuous Learner: Stay updated with industry trends and emerging technologies to enhance cross-functional capabilities.
How to apply
Ready to join this role? Click Apply now to submit your resume and share your availability and expected salary with us!
We encourage applications from individuals of all backgrounds who are excited about shaping the future of robotics and automation.
All information received will be kept strictly confidential and will be used only for employment-related purposes.
Low Jia Yi | R25127265
#SmartHire
How do your skills match this job?
How do your skills match this job?
Sign in and update your profile to get insights.
Your application will include the following questions:
- Which of the following statements best describes your right to work in Singapore?
- What’s your expected monthly basic salary?
- How many years' experience do you have as a C# Developer?
- How much notice are you required to give your current employer?
- How many years' experience do you have as a C++ Developer?
To help fast track investigation, please include here any other relevant details that prompted you to report this job ad as fraudulent / misleading / discriminatory.
Researching careers? Find all the information and tips you need on career advice.